Key Features
  • Powered by NVlDlA GeForce RTX 5090 GPU with 32GB GDDR7 memory for ultra-high-performance gaming and AI workloads.
  • 32GB GDDR7 memory with a 512-bit memory interface delivers exceptional bandwidth for 4K and 8K gaming, rendering, and content creation.
  • WINDFORCE Cooling System with advanced thermal design helps maintain optimal temperatures under heavy workloads.
  • Dual BIOS lets you switch between Performance Mode for maximum power and Quiet Mode for reduced noise.
  • Reinforced metal structure with versatile VGA support stand improves durability and helps prevent GPU sag.
  • Model Number: GV-N5090GAMING OC-32GD
  • Powered by the NVIDIA Blackwell architecture and DLSS 4
  • Powered by GeForce RTX 5060 Ti
  • Integrated with 8GB GDDR7 128bit memory interface
  • PCIe 5.0
  • WINDFORCE cooling system
  • Hawk fan
  • Server-grade Thermal conductive gel
  • Reinforced structure
